## Session Handling for Health Checks

The Corvel gateway sits behind the Lanternside load balancer, which probes /healthz every ten seconds. Health-check requests are stateless by design: they bypass the session store entirely so that probe traffic never inflates session counts or evicts real user sessions. New team members should note that the deep-check endpoint, /healthz/deep, does verify session-store connectivity and therefore requires authentication. When probing it manually, supply the token below.

bearer token for tajep-kajef: eyJhbGciOiJIUzI1NiIsInR5cCI6IkpXVCJ9.eyJzdWIiOiIoOsZ23In0.CsygO0hs

Handover — night shift

Goods lift B is reserved for the Fenwright Paper delivery until 04:00. Keep the loading bay shutter down between trolley runs and don't let anyone else book the lift. Driver knows to buzz the dock intercom. Sign the manifest before he leaves. The lift lobby door locks after midnight, so you'll need the code below.

badge for badup-kahif: bdg-LHI-9

Handover — from Ilsen to Darrow, for the external plugin author audience. The Tidemark firmware update channel pushes signed images to Larkspool devices over the staged rollout ring. Plugins may subscribe to channel events but must never publish; publishing rights stay with the release signer. Manifests are verified twice: at ingest and on-device. The signing enclave seals itself after seven idle days, which will happen before Darrow starts. To reopen the enclave and resume publishing, enter the recovery passphrase below.

recovery phrase for hawif-kahap: novath-tamys-rusath-briix-eliix-zorael-raldor-rusael-quenys-istax

Hello new team members,

As part of our quarterly security cycle at Brindlemore Systems, we are rotating the credentials used by the Chalkline school timetable solver's internal constraint service. The previous key will remain valid until end of day Thursday, after which all solver requests authenticated with it will be rejected. Please update your local development configuration and any shared staging environments you maintain. For your convenience, the replacement key for the constraint service is included directly below.

app token of yagap-fajef = kto4_5vzY